At AECOM , we are currently recruiting for a Document Controller:Rail projects to join our Dublin office.

The Document Controller:Rail projects supports teams across the PMO function by overseeing document storage, sharing, and governance protocols. Acting as a primary point of contact for documentation-related queries across the organisation, the role holder plays a key part in maintaining efficient and compliant document management processes.

As a member of the document controls team, the Document Controller is responsible for monitoring the implementation of document control tools, managing document management systems, and providing guidance and support to junior document controllers. The role also ensures compliance with organisational standards and procedures, maintains accurate and up-to-date records, and identifies opportunities for process improvement.

Through effective coordination and oversight, the Document Controller helps drive consistent and efficient document management throughout the full project lifecycle.

  • Oversee the creation, tracking, and storage of documents within a centralised repository, ensuring effective organisation and ease of access and retrieval.

  • Develop, implement, and maintain version control procedures to ensure the use of current and accurate documentation, while preserving historical records for audit and reference purposes.

  • Ensure the accurate management of documentation, including monitoring revisions and maintaining consistency across document versions.

  • Coordinate and optimise the distribution of documents to internal and external stakeholders, ensuring timely and accurate communication of critical information.

  • Ensure all documentation complies with organisational policies, industry standards, and regulatory requirements, maintaining consistency in document formats, templates, and procedures.

  • Manage and control document access permissions to protect sensitive information and ensure appropriate access for authorised personnel only.

  • Support effective communication and collaboration with team members, stakeholders, and vendors to facilitate efficient document exchange and updates.

  • Coordinate document review and approval workflows, ensuring timely revisions, feedback, and approvals from relevant stakeholders.

  • Maintain accurate records of document history, including revisions, approvals, and distribution logs, to support audits and future reference requirements.

  • Produce and analyse reports relating to document status, activities, and compliance to support project management and informed decision-making.

  • Identify opportunities to enhance document management processes and systems, implementing improvements to support evolving project and organisational requirements.

  • Prioritise tasks effectively to meet deadlines and ensure efficient document flow throughout all phases of the project lifecycle.

  • Proactively identify and resolve document management issues, implementing practical and timely solutions to minimise disruption.

  • Provide guidance, mentoring, and support to junior document controllers, promoting collaboration and maintaining high team performance standards.

  • Undertake additional duties, tasks, or responsibilities as required to support the successful delivery of the role and wider team objectives
